From Geopolitics to the Kitchen Table with Andy Davis

<p>When Andy Davis first heard “energy security,” he thought what most people think. Oil. Nuclear. Geopolitics. A problem that lived somewhere far away, between governments.</p><p>He had more reason than most to think that way. As an Army Ranger, he parachuted into Iraq on the night of the invasion and later spent ten days in a firefight on top of the Haditha Dam, one of the largest power-generating facilities in the country. There was intel it would be blown to flood the Euphrates and trap American troops. His mortar crews were hitting the substations below. At the time, it was a mission. Years later, working for one of the largest dam owners in the world, he found himself giving public tours of hydroelectric dams and realized he’d been standing on top of one of these structures under fire long before he ever explained one to a crowd.</p><p>That full circle is the heart of this conversation, but it isn’t really the point. The point is what changed in how Andy sees the work.</p><p>His argument is simple: energy security stopped being a geopolitical abstraction for him and became a kitchen-table issue. People want the lights to stay on and the bill to stay predictable. Most of them have no idea where the power actually comes from or what the charges mean. He thinks the industry has a job to do there, and that most of these arguments are won or lost not in Washington but in a town hall or at someone’s kitchen table.</p><p>Kevin pushes on this from his own experience riding out hurricanes in Houston, where a small home microgrid is the difference between his kids streaming on their iPads and the neighbors huddled around a candle.</p><p>There’s also a straight answer here for veterans wondering how to break into energy, and it has less to do with credentials than you’d expect.</p><p>Andy didn’t plan any of this. How a Marine Lands in Energy Policy

<p>Most service members start thinking seriously about life after the uniform six months out. Jim Purekal started two years out. He networked, he sat down with people who had nothing in common with his career, and he treated the whole thing like a mission with a deadline.</p><p>That discipline is how a retired Marine Corps major with twenty years in aviation ended up running Virginia legislative work for Advanced Energy United, a national trade association.</p><p>It is also why this episode is useful for anyone who is actually thinking about energy as a second career.</p><p>Jim spent his last active duty stretch on Capitol Hill as a congressional fellow in Senator Perdue’s office, then retired out of the Pentagon. He used SkillBridge to land at SunPower for twelve weeks during the pandemic, learning the industry from the inside on a DOD paycheck. His take on that program is direct: if a service member is six months from getting out and their command does not have a plan for them, that is a leadership gap.</p><p>The conversation gets into the work itself. Most days, Jim is in Richmond during the General Assembly session, working bills, educating lawmakers, meeting with member companies. Virginia sits inside PJM, the regional grid operator covering thirteen states and DC. Demand is climbing fast. Data centers, building electrification, transportation. The decisions that shape how the grid actually gets built happen in state capitals, not on cable news.</p><p>Jim and Kevin also dig into the harder question for transitioning veterans. What soft skills actually transfer. What the learning curve looks like. Why sales, policy, and project development are real landing spots, not just the technical trades. And what Jim wishes he had known when he was the one buttoning up his resume and asking strangers for a conversation.</p><p>The Solar Ready Vets program that helped Jim get placed has since been cut. Don't Play Small with Marcus Barnes

<p>About seven percent of Americans have served in the military. The number who actually make it from a uniform into a career that fits is smaller than it should be, and the people who fall through the cracks most often are not the officers with MBAs. They’re the junior enlisted.</p><p>That’s the gap Marcus Barnes works in every day.</p><p>Marcus is a Marine Corps veteran and the Energy Program Manager at NextOp Vets, the Houston-based nonprofit Kevin has long called one of the best junior enlisted placement organizations in the sector. NextOp focuses on the E3 to E7 sweet spot, the rank range where transition is hardest and the industry’s recruiting machinery is weakest. Marcus’s specific job is to take that pipeline of talent and connect it to oil and gas, utilities, and renewables.</p><p>The conversation gets practical fast. Kevin and Marcus walk through how NextOp actually works, how employers plug in without paying to play, and where Project Vanguard’s swim lane ends and NextOp’s begins. PV builds the peer network. NextOp does the placement. The handoff matters, and most veterans don’t know either piece exists.</p><p>The other half of the episode is the human side. Marcus gets out of the Marines after six and a half years, walks into a staffing agency, and gets told his job is called HR. He didn’t know what HR was. He’s open about how often transitioning vets assume free resources are for somebody else, not them, and how much that single mindset costs people.</p><p>His parting advice is simple:</p><p>Don’t play small.</p><p>If you know a transitioning service member, especially a junior enlisted one staring at a graduation date with no plan, this is the episode to send them.
